Congaree National Park

The expansive Congaree National Park offers a unique glimpse into one of the largest intact old-growth bottomland hardwood forests in the United States. Visitors can explore miles of trails that weave through towering trees and lush wetlands. The rich biodiversity supports various wildlife, including deer, owls, and the occasional bobcat. A stroll along the boardwalk makes it accessible for all ages while providing opportunities for birdwatching and photography.

Kayaking and canoeing along the park's waterways allows for a different perspective of the serene landscape. The park frequently hosts educational programs highlighting the importance of conservation and the natural history of the area. Seasonal changes transform the scenery, making each visit a new experience. For those looking to escape urban life, Congaree National Park serves as a peaceful retreat amid nature's beauty.

EdVenture Children's Museum

This interactive museum is designed to ignite curiosity in children of all ages. With hands-on exhibits that encourage exploration, kids can learn about science, technology, engineering, arts, and mathematics in fun and engaging ways. One of the museum's standout attractions is the life-sized replica of a child which allows visitors to explore body systems through immersive play. Another popular exhibit features water areas where young ones can experiment with floating and sinking, illustrating fundamental scientific principles.

Families visiting will find a range of programming throughout the week, including special events and workshops that cater to varying interests. The vibrant atmosphere stimulates creativity while also fostering learning through play. With easy accessibility and engaging staff, the museum provides a welcoming environment for both children and their caregivers. Parents will appreciate the opportunity for their children to learn through engaging activities while creating lasting memories.
